module Bruijn (Term(..), bruijn, freeVariablesIn) where
import Data.Maybe (listToMaybe)
import Data.Set (Set, empty, singleton, union)
import qualified Lambda as U
import Evaluation (Strategy)
data Term
= Free String
| Bound0
| Scope Term
| Lambda Strategy Term
| Apply Term Term
deriving (Read, Show, Eq, Ord)
bruijn :: U.Term -> Term
bruijn = bruijn' []
bruijn' :: [String] -> U.Term -> Term
bruijn' m (U.Apply s t) = Apply (bruijn' m s) (bruijn' m t)
bruijn' m (U.Lambda k v t) = Lambda k (bruijn' (v : m) t)
bruijn' m (U.Variable v) =
case genericElemIndex v m of
Nothing -> Free v
Just i -> applyN i Scope Bound0
applyN :: Integer -> (a -> a) -> a -> a
applyN n f
| n == 0 = id
| otherwise = f . applyN (n - 1) f
freeVariablesIn :: Term -> Set String
freeVariablesIn (Free v) = singleton v
freeVariablesIn Bound0 = empty
freeVariablesIn (Scope t) = freeVariablesIn t
freeVariablesIn (Lambda _ t) = freeVariablesIn t
freeVariablesIn (Apply s t) = freeVariablesIn s `union` freeVariablesIn t
